Subject: Watchdog ownership transfer — KioskKeeper

Team,

Effective next sprint, responsibility for the KioskKeeper watchdog on the Orbita self-service kiosks moves out of the Platform Guild. The watchdog restarts the shell app after heap exhaustion and logs crash bundles to the Larkspur archive; its restart thresholds are deliberately conservative, so please do not tune them without review. Going forward, all alerts, patches, and escalations route to the new owner named below.

approver of yajef-fajef = Oliwyn Silion Kasok Kasox

# Service Accounts for Admin Table Bulk Edits

Welcome aboard! When you run bulk edits in the Fennwick admin table (status flips, reassignment sweeps, that kind of thing), don't use your personal login — use the dedicated service account so the audit log stays clean.

The bulk-edit worker talks to the internal Fennwick mutation API, which ignores session cookies entirely and only accepts key auth. Rate limits are generous but real, so batch in chunks of 500.

The key the worker should use is:

gateway credential: kto23_LX9A4ys6i4nzHtpOLNLodKK

Finance Review Summary — Hedging Decision

Reviewed Q3 exposure on the Velran crown following the Osterfeld expansion. Forward contracts locked for 70% of projected receivables; remainder floats per Tavrin's model. Cost of carry acceptable; downside capped at tolerance threshold. No objections from treasury. Decision stands through year-end unless volatility doubles. The strategic rationale behind the partial hedge is noted below.

confidential, bahop-hahif: Only 3 of the 140 pilot accounts renewed Oliath, so a churn review is set for July 15.

Changelog — Spokeshift v3.2, changed defaults

Rebalancing runs now default to 15-minute intervals instead of hourly. Truck capacity estimation uses live dock counts, not the static table. Overflow stations are skipped rather than queued. On-call: alerts fire on two consecutive failed runs, not one. Roll back by pinning v3.1. The full set of new default configuration values is listed below.

settings of taguf-fajef:
[eliath]
team = julir
access_code = ac_78465c
host = eliath.lumicgrid.local
port = 8443
owner = feniel.wenir
peer = quenmir.tolvaqsys.local